About

This is a channel dedicated to uploading music that, I, personally want for Super Smash Bros. Ultimate. I do not claim that these songs will be in the final game. Knowing that there will be 800+ tracks, I'm hoping for either ported or remixes of the music that I post onto the channel.

How is the revenue estimate calculated?

It's a rough public estimate based on a $0.7–$2.0 CPM (revenue per 1,000 views) applied to view counts — not actual creator earnings, which depend on ad rates, audience geography, and monetization settings YouTube doesn't expose publicly.
